Besides soaking the offending parts in Kroil for a week, are there any "magic" ways of loosening the triple square headed adjusters (rear camber)?. If not, and I have to cut or grind them out, where can I get a new set (both sides) of the camber eccentrics, bolts and nuts other than the dealer? Thanks for your knowledge. Paul, Providence

Triple Square? Mine were standard 6 sided. If the nut comes off, use a light hammer to push the bolt out. If the bolt does not turn, it should break loose with the hammer, but I would secure new bolts before using the hammer as the bolt may distort too much.

ECS has them as do several other parts places:
